相关疑难解决方法(0)

错误的ERR!代码ELIFECYCLE

我正在尝试学习反应,所以我有这个示例代码为fullstack反应投票应用程序,我试图让它工作,但在运行npm install后跟npm start我收到以下错误:

npm ERR! Darwin 16.4.0
npm ERR! argv "/usr/local/bin/node" "/usr/local/bin/npm" "run" "server"
npm ERR! node v7.5.0
npm ERR! npm  v4.3.0
npm ERR! file sh
npm ERR! code ELIFECYCLE
npm ERR! errno ENOENT
npm ERR! syscall spawn
npm ERR! voting_app@1.1.0 server: `live-server --public --    
host=localhost --port=3000 --middleware=./disable-browser-cache.js`
npm ERR! spawn ENOENT
npm ERR!
npm ERR! Failed at the voting_app@1.1.0 server script 'live-server --
public --host=localhost --port=3000 --middleware=./disable-browser- 
cache.js'.
npm ERR! Make sure you have the latest version of node.js …
Run Code Online (Sandbox Code Playgroud)

node.js npm-install npm-start

156
推荐指数
16
解决办法
34万
查看次数

无法从react-script卸载webpack

我试图做一个todo-app in react,这对我来说是新的.但是一旦安装了webpack,npm start就开始工作了.它给了我:

my-todo-react@0.1.0 start/home/hanna/Desktop/projects/my-todo-react react-scripts start

项目依赖关系树可能存在问题.它可能不是Create React App中的错误,而是您需要在本地修复的内容.

Create React App提供的react-scripts包需要依赖:

"webpack":"4.19.1"

不要尝试手动安装它:您的包管理器会自动进行安装.但是,在树中检测到更高版本的webpack:

/ home/hanna/node_modules/webpack(version:4.20.2)

已知手动安装不兼容的版本会导致难以调试的问题.

如果想忽略此检查,请将SKIP_PREFLIGHT_CHECK = true添加到项目中的.env文件中.这将永久禁用此消息,但您可能会遇到其他问题.

要修复依赖关系树,请按照确切的顺序尝试执行以下步骤:

  1. 删除项目文件夹中的package-lock.json(不是package.json!)和/或yarn.lock.
  2. 删除项目文件夹中的node_modules.
  3. 从项目文件夹中package.json文件中的依赖项和/或devDependencies中删除"webpack".
  4. 运行npm install或yarn,具体取决于您使用的包管理器.

在大多数情况下,这应该足以解决问题.如果这没有帮助,您可以尝试其他一些事项:

  1. 如果您使用了npm,请安装yarn(http://yarnpkg.com/)并重复上述步骤.这可能会有所帮助,因为npm已知包裹提升的问题,可能会在将来的版本中得到解决.

  2. 检查/ home/hanna/node_modules/webpack是否在项目目录之外.例如,您可能不小心在主文件夹中安装了某些内容.

  3. 尝试在项目文件夹中运行npm ls webpack.这将告诉您安装webpack的其他软件包(除了预期的react-scripts).

如果没有其他帮助,请将SKIP_PREFLIGHT_CHECK = true添加到项目中的.env文件中.这将永久禁用此预检检查,以防您仍然想要继续.

PS我们知道此消息很长但请阅读上述步骤:-)我们希望您发现它们有用!

错误的ERR!代码ELIFECYCLE npm ERR!错误1 npm ERR!my-todo-react@0.1.0开始:react-scripts start npm ERR!退出状态1 npm ERR!错误的ERR!在my-todo-react@0.1.0启动脚本失败.错误的ERR!这可能不是npm的问题.上面可能有额外的日志记录输出.

错误的ERR!可以在以下位置找到此运行的完整日志:npm ERR!/home/hanna/.npm/_logs/2018-10-02T10_39_06_361Z-debug.log

node.js npm reactjs webpack react-native

15
推荐指数
4
解决办法
1万
查看次数

Create React App提供的react-scripts软件包需要依赖项:

项目依赖关系树可能存在问题。这可能不是Create React App中的错误,而是您需要在本地修复的问题。

Create React App提供的react-scripts软件包需要依赖项:

“ babel-eslint”:“ 9.0.0”

不要尝试手动安装它:包管理器会自动安装它。但是,在树的较高位置检测到了另一个版本的babel-eslint:

javascript reactjs react-router react-native react-redux

9
推荐指数
5
解决办法
6296
查看次数

创建 React App 需要一个依赖项:"babel-loader": "8.1.0"

项目依赖树可能有问题。这可能不是 Create React App 中的错误,而是您需要在本地修复的问题。

Create React App 提供的 react-scripts 包需要一个依赖:

"babel-loader": "8.1.0"

不要尝试手动安装:您的包管理器会自动安装。但是,在树的更高位置检测到了不同版本的 babel-loader:

D:\Reactjs\node_modules\babel-loader(版本:8.0.6)

众所周知,手动安装不兼容的版本会导致难以调试的问题。

如果您希望忽略此检查,请将 SKIP_PREFLIGHT_CHECK=true 添加到项目中的 .e nv 文件中。这将永久禁用此消息,但您可能会遇到其他问题。

要修复依赖树,请尝试按照以下确切顺序执行以下步骤:

  1. 删除项目文件夹中的 package-lock.json(不是 package.json!)和/或 yarn.lock。
  2. 删除项目文件夹中的 node_modules。
  3. 从项目文件夹中的 packa ge.json 文件中的依赖项和/或 devDependencies 中删除“babel-loader”。
  4. 运行 npm install 或 yarn,具体取决于您使用的包管理器。

在大多数情况下,这应该足以解决问题。如果这没有帮助,您还可以尝试其他一些方法:

  1. 如果您使用 npm,请安装 yarn ( http://yarnpkg.com/ ) 并用它重复上述步骤。这可能会有所帮助,因为 npm 存在已知的包提升问题,这些问题可能会在未来版本中得到解决。

  2. 检查 D:\Reactjs\node_modules\babel-loader 是否在你的项目目录之外。例如,您可能不小心在家中安装了一些较旧的东西。

  3. 尝试在您的项目文件夹中运行 npm ls babel-loader。这将告诉您安装了 babel-loader 的其他包(除了预期的 react-scrip ts)。

如果没有其他帮助,请将 SKIP_PREFLIGHT_CHECK=true 添加到项目中的 .env 文件中。如果您无论如何都想继续,这将永久禁用此预检检查。

reactjs babel-loader

9
推荐指数
3
解决办法
1万
查看次数

使用Webpack创建React App依赖性问题

我正在学习Lynda的学习反应课程.在第3章的第二个视频中,我面临一个问题.当我在Git Bash上键入npm start时,显示以下错误:

$ npm start

> bulletin-board@0.1.0 start C:\Users\John\Desktop\Ex_Files_Learning_Reactjs\Files\Ch03\03_02\start\bulletin-board
> react-scripts start


There might be a problem with the project dependency tree.
It is likely not a bug in Create React App, but something you need to fix locally.

The react-scripts package provided by Create React App requires a dependency:

  "webpack": "4.19.1"

Don't try to install it manually: your package manager does it automatically.
However, a different version of webpack was detected higher up in the tree:

  C:\Users\John\node_modules\webpack (version: …
Run Code Online (Sandbox Code Playgroud)

npm reactjs

8
推荐指数
3
解决办法
2826
查看次数

如何使用 npm-start 解决 react webpack 问题

这是我的错误页面:

项目依赖树可能有问题。这可能不是 Create React App 中的错误,而是您需要在本地修复的问题。

Create React App 提供的 react-scripts 包需要一个依赖:

"webpack": "4.19.1"

不要尝试手动安装:您的包管理器会自动安装。但是,在树的更高位置检测到了不同版本的 webpack:

C:\Users\Acer\node_modules\webpack(版本:4.28.3)

众所周知,手动安装不兼容的版本会导致难以调试的问题。

如果您希望忽略此检查,请将 SKIP_PREFLIGHT_CHECK=true 添加到项目中的 .env 文件中。这将永久禁用此消息,但您可能会遇到其他问题。

要修复依赖树,请尝试按照以下确切顺序执行以下步骤:

  1. 删除项目文件夹中的 package-lock.json(不是 package.json!)和/或 yarn.lock。
  2. 删除项目文件夹中的 node_modules。
  3. 从项目文件夹中的 package.json 文件中的依赖项和/或 devDependencies 中删除“webpack”。
  4. 运行 npm install 或 yarn,具体取决于您使用的包管理器。

在大多数情况下,这应该足以解决问题。如果这没有帮助,您还可以尝试其他一些方法:

  1. 如果您使用 npm,请安装 yarn ( http://yarnpkg.com/ ) 并用它重复上述步骤。这可能会有所帮助,因为 npm 存在已知的包提升问题,这些问题可能会在未来版本中得到解决。

  2. 检查 C:\Users\Acer\node_modules\webpack 是否在您的项目目录之外。例如,您可能不小心在主文件夹中安装了某些东西。

  3. 尝试在您的项目文件夹中运行 npm ls webpack。这将告诉您安装了 webpack 的其他包(除了预期的 react-scripts)。

如果没有其他帮助,请将 SKIP_PREFLIGHT_CHECK=true 添加到项目中的 .env 文件中。如果您无论如何都想继续,这将永久禁用此预检检查。

PS 我们知道这条消息很长,但请阅读上面的步骤 :-) 我们希望它们对您有所帮助!

npm ERR! code ELIFECYCLE
npm ERR! errno 1
npm ERR! first-app@0.1.0 …
Run Code Online (Sandbox Code Playgroud)

npm reactjs webpack

8
推荐指数
1
解决办法
7164
查看次数

响应Web应用程序的本地服务器上部署时的eslint错误

项目依赖关系树可能存在问题.它可能不是Create React App中的错误,而是您需要在本地修复的内容.

Create React App提供的react-scripts包需要依赖:

"eslint": "5.6.0"
Run Code Online (Sandbox Code Playgroud)

不要尝试手动安装它:您的包管理器会自动进行安装.但是,在树中检测到更高版本的eslint:

D:\chintu\blog-exambunker-master\blog-exambunker-master\node_modules\eslint (version: 5.6.1)
Run Code Online (Sandbox Code Playgroud)

如何安装5.6.0我安装eslint 的版本它总是安装最新版本,有人可以建议我该怎么办?

reactjs

6
推荐指数
2
解决办法
6868
查看次数

之后尝试启动 React 时出错(项目依赖树可能有问题....)

我已经从 npx create-react-app 创建了 React App。而且,我尝试 cd 并启动该应用程序,它显示此错误。我也尝试过使用纱线并重新安装节点。我非常迷茫,因为它在 30 分钟前也在呼啸而过。我做的唯一一件事是 npm i -g npm 来更新 npm,从那时起它就不起作用了。

We suggest that you begin by typing:

  cd giact
  yarn start

Happy hacking!
gi@Gis-Macbook-Pro study % cd giact
gi@Gis-Macbook-Pro giact % npm start

> giact@0.1.0 start /Users/gi/Desktop/Study/giact
> react-scripts start


There might be a problem with the project dependency tree.
It is likely not a bug in Create React App, but something you need to fix locally.

The react-scripts package provided by Create React …
Run Code Online (Sandbox Code Playgroud)

node.js npm reactjs

5
推荐指数
1
解决办法
4741
查看次数

为什么我的主文件夹下有一个 node_modules 文件夹?

我已经在/usr/local/lib/node_modules 中有一个全局node_modules文件夹,但我刚刚发现我的主文件夹下还有一个~/node_modules文件夹。我可以删除这个吗?

我执行node -e "console.log(global.module.paths)" ,我得到:

[ '/Users/Username/node_modules',
'/Users/node_modules',
 '/node_modules' ]
Run Code Online (Sandbox Code Playgroud)

如果我删除主目录下的node_modules文件夹,则执行npm list @vue/cli-ui. 应该是这个错误:

[ '/Users/Username/node_modules',
'/Users/node_modules',
 '/node_modules' ]
Run Code Online (Sandbox Code Playgroud)

那么,我可以删除我的主目录下的node_modules文件夹吗?它有什么用?还是我需要重新安装 Node.js 和 npm?

如果我确实删除了这个文件夹,当我执行时npm ls,我会得到这些错误:

/Users/Username
??? UNMET DEPENDENCY @vue/cli-ui@3.0.1
npm ERR! missing: @vue/cli-ui@3.0.1, required by Username
Run Code Online (Sandbox Code Playgroud)

我怎么解决这个问题?


现在执行后一切正常npm cache verify

node.js npm vue-cli-3

4
推荐指数
1
解决办法
3235
查看次数

npm 运行构建时出错?eslint 包错误

npm 启动

Pushercoins@0.1.0 启动反应脚本启动

项目依赖树可能有问题。这可能不是 Create React App 中的错误,而是您需要在本地修复的问题。

Create React App 提供的react-scripts 包需要依赖:

“eslint”:“^7.11.0”

不要尝试手动安装它:您的包管理器会自动安装。然而,在树的更高层检测到了不同版本的 eslint:

/Users/sujit_jaiwaliya/node_modules/eslint (版本:6.8.0)

npm reactjs

3
推荐指数
1
解决办法
8696
查看次数

需要帮助解决我不断收到的 React.js 错误

每次我尝试在新项目上运行 npm start 时,我都会不断收到此错误。有谁知道或知道如何解决这个问题?

项目依赖树可能有问题。这可能不是 Create React App 中的错误,而是您需要在本地修复的问题。

Create React App 提供的react-scripts 包需要依赖:

"babel-jest": "^26.6.0"

不要尝试手动安装它:您的包管理器会自动安装。然而,在树的更高层检测到了不同版本的 babel-jest:

D:\node_modules\babel-jest(版本:24.9.0)

已知手动安装不兼容的版本会导致难以调试的问题。

如果您希望忽略此检查,请将 SKIP_PREFLIGHT_CHECK=true 添加到项目中的 .env 文件中。这将永久禁用此消息,但您可能会遇到其他问题。

要修复依赖关系树,请尝试按确切顺序执行以下步骤:

  1. 删除项目文件夹中的package-lock.json(不是package.json!)和/或yarn.lock。
  2. 删除项目文件夹中的node_modules。
  3. 从项目文件夹中的 package.json 文件中的依赖项和/或 devDependency 中删除“babel-jest”。
  4. 运行 npm install 或yarn,具体取决于您使用的包管理器。

在大多数情况下,这应该足以解决问题。如果这没有帮助,您可以尝试其他一些方法:

  1. 如果您使用npm,请安装yarn(http://yarnpkg.com/)并重复上述步骤。这可能会有所帮助,因为 npm 已知软件包提升问题,这些问题可能会在未来版本中得到解决。

  2. 检查 D:\node_modules\babel-jest 是否在项目目录之外。例如,您可能不小心在主文件夹中安装了某些内容。

  3. 尝试在项目文件夹中运行 npm ls babel-jest 。这将告诉你哪个其他包(除了预期的反应脚本)安装了 babel-jest。

如果没有其他帮助,请将 SKIP_PREFLIGHT_CHECK=true 添加到项目中的 .env 文件中。如果您仍想继续,这将永久禁用此飞行前检查。

PS 我们知道此消息很长,但请阅读上面的步骤:-) 我们希望它们对您有所帮助!

npm 错误!代码 ELIFECYCLE npm 错误!errno 1 npm 错误!react-portfolio@0.1.0 开始:react-scripts startnpm 错误!退出状态 1 npm ERR!npm 错误!在react-portfolio@0.1.0 启动脚本处失败。npm 错误!这可能不是 npm …

javascript npm reactjs

3
推荐指数
2
解决办法
1万
查看次数